pub struct BookingPartReference {
pub id: String,
pub summary: Option<Option<String>>,
pub _links: Option<Vec<Link>>,
}Expand description
BookingPartReference : References all the booking part elements in an uniform format. In its part, a BookingPartReference can refer to reservation, admission, ancillary or fee.
Fields§
§id: String§summary: Option<Option<String>>A human-readable description of the booking part reference.
_links: Option<Vec<Link>>Java Property Name: ‘links’
Implementations§
Source§impl BookingPartReference
impl BookingPartReference
Sourcepub fn new(id: String) -> BookingPartReference
pub fn new(id: String) -> BookingPartReference
References all the booking part elements in an uniform format. In its part, a BookingPartReference can refer to reservation, admission, ancillary or fee.
Trait Implementations§
Source§impl Clone for BookingPartReference
impl Clone for BookingPartReference
Source§fn clone(&self) -> BookingPartReference
fn clone(&self) -> BookingPartReference
Returns a duplicate of the value. Read more
1.0.0 · Source§fn clone_from(&mut self, source: &Self)
fn clone_from(&mut self, source: &Self)
Performs copy-assignment from
source. Read moreSource§impl Debug for BookingPartReference
impl Debug for BookingPartReference
Source§impl Default for BookingPartReference
impl Default for BookingPartReference
Source§fn default() -> BookingPartReference
fn default() -> BookingPartReference
Returns the “default value” for a type. Read more
Source§impl<'de> Deserialize<'de> for BookingPartReference
impl<'de> Deserialize<'de> for BookingPartReference
Source§fn deserialize<__D>(__deserializer: __D) -> Result<Self, __D::Error>where
__D: Deserializer<'de>,
fn deserialize<__D>(__deserializer: __D) -> Result<Self, __D::Error>where
__D: Deserializer<'de>,
Deserialize this value from the given Serde deserializer. Read more
Source§impl PartialEq for BookingPartReference
impl PartialEq for BookingPartReference
Source§impl Serialize for BookingPartReference
impl Serialize for BookingPartReference
impl StructuralPartialEq for BookingPartReference
Auto Trait Implementations§
impl Freeze for BookingPartReference
impl RefUnwindSafe for BookingPartReference
impl Send for BookingPartReference
impl Sync for BookingPartReference
impl Unpin for BookingPartReference
impl UnwindSafe for BookingPartReference
Blanket Implementations§
Source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
Source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more